There is no separate GF menu and GF items are not marked on the menu, but they can modify many items to be GF, and can use GF penne in the pasta dishes. The chef came out to discuss with us, which was reassuring. They say that they make a point of taking food allergies seriously. Food was good and portions were very generous. The chef personally explained the precautions he takes in the kitchen for my GF pasta: dedicated pot, fresh water, clean tongs, etc. The meal was yummy and I didn't feel sick!

The chef comes out and speaks with you. They have GF corn pasta. All their sauces are GF and many can be made dairy free if you ask. I do wish they had bread, but they do let you bring it with you.

This is the second Maggiano’s I have eaten at in the last 2 months and while my experience was great in Philadelphia, it was even better in Bridgewater. On a busy Saturday night, the lead chef came out to speak with me and told me he would personally be preparing my food. He asked for my order ahead of time so that when it was placed with the waiter, he would already know what I needed. GF pasta is cooked in separate space and all the meat dishes can be made with no breading on a separate grill. The sauces and salad dressings are gluten free as well - the only area that’s lacking is their appetizers as none can be made gluten free, but I just got a bigger salad. Our food took a bit of time to come out because that particular chef was preparing it, but I absolutely didn’t mind at all and it was delicious. All of the wait staff we encountered knew the protocol and they announced the “allergy” meal when they came out.
